The Greater Lafourche Port Commission issued a proclamation honoring the life and public service of Larry Griffin, who died July 29, 2024. A member of the commission for more than three decades, Griffin served as a commissioner beginning in November 1992 and held roles as president, vice president and treasurer during his tenure.
A proclamation read by a commission member said, "Whereas the members of the Board of Commissioners of the Port Commission have learned with deep regret and sorrow of the death of Mister Larry Griffin on July 29, 2024," and went on to describe Griffin's long service to the business community and port-related industries. Commissioners and colleagues recalled his mentorship and humor; family members were invited forward to receive the resolution.
Commissioners described Griffin as the commission's longest-serving member and thanked him for his contributions to the port and community. The commission closed the presentation by inviting family onto the dais and offering brief remarks of remembrance.
No formal action beyond the reading and presentation of the proclamation was recorded; the reading was introduced as a resolution previously passed by the Port Commission on Oct. 17, 2024.
